Southsea Hoverport station keeps things straightforward, focusing on essential services. The station operates a concise ticket office with opening hours from Monday to Friday at 6:00 to 20:00, slightly reduced at weekends. However, note that there are no ticket machines or facilities to collect tickets bought online. While the station may not have elaborate lounges or shopping outlets to boast about, it makes up with step-free access throughout, ensuring convenience for all travelers. There's also an induction loop for those with hearing difficulties and accessible toilets.
If you're wondering about getting to, from, and around Southsea, the hoverport station has you covered with various travel options. Taxis are readily located outside the terminal for swift and private transportation. For the more ecologically minded or those who love public transport, the HoverBus (H1) connects the station with pivotal local spots such as The Hard Interchange for Portsmouth Harbour and the Gosport Ferry. There's also a National Express service right outside the terminal, perfect for extending your travel horizons beyond local boundaries.

Rhiwbina Station provides various essential facilities to ensure a smooth journey for all travelers. While there is no ticket office on-site, ticket machines are available for travelers to collect pre-purchased tickets conveniently. These machines accept major credit and debit cards but do not accept cash payments. The station is equipped with smartcard validators and an induction loop to assist hearing-impaired passengers.
Accessibility is a key focus at Rhiwbina, with step-free access available via end-of-platform ramps, although some uneven terrain might require attention. CCTV ensures a safe environment for passengers, and while there isn't a dedicated waiting room or refreshment facilities, ample seating is provided to ensure comfort while waiting for your train.
Traveling from Rhiwbina doesn’t just stop at the train station; diverse onward travel options make it a well-connected exchange. Local bus services offer an array of routes to complement your train journey, ensuring a seamless transition to your final destination. In the event of rail replacement services, buses can be accessed conveniently at the station entrance, positioned near the library for quick and easy boarding.
